Manchester City are reportedly interested in signing Bayern Munich's utility star ahead of next season.

Manchester City boss Pep Guardiola is reportedly lining up a move for Bayern Munich's versatile star Joshua Kimmich.

After winning just one trophy last season, the City boss is aiming to increase the quality in his squad and has identified a potential high-level target.

Kimmich to reunite with Guardiola at Manchester City?

Kimmich, 29, was openly critical of teammates as they lost the Bundesliga title to Xabi Alonso's Bayer Leverkusen.

He is also reportedly unsettled at the Allianz Arena.

Bayern Munich star Joshua Kimmich (L)

The Germany international has just one year left on his contract, a situation that could make a transfer to Manchester City a bit easier to complete.

However, according to Sport Bible, Guardiola will have to break his own transfer rule to complete the signing.

The Catalan reportedly avoids signing players he’s worked with at a previous club.
